Aluminum alloy window broken bridge structure
The invention discloses an aluminum alloy window broken bridge structure. According to the technical scheme, the aluminum alloy window broken bridge structure comprises an upper supporting frame and alower supporting frame, wherein inner rails and outer rails are arranged on the upper supporting frame and the lower supporting frame, an outer glass plate is arranged on the outer rails, an inner glass plate is arranged on the inner rails, an auxiliary moving assembly is arranged between the inner rails and the inner glass plate, the auxiliary moving assembly comprises an auxiliary moving plateand auxiliary moving balls arranged on the auxiliary moving plate, a first clamping groove is formed in the upper portion of the auxiliary moving plate and used for allowing the inner rails to be clamped in, the auxiliary moving plate is in sliding connection with the inner rails, a second groove for allowing the inner glass plate to be embedded is formed in the lower portion of the auxiliary moving plate, the inner glass plate is fixedly connected with the lower end of the auxiliary moving plate, and the auxiliary moving plate is internally embedded with a nylon strip for prevention of heating loss. According to the aluminum alloy window broken bridge structure, the heat preservation effect can be effectively achieved, heat insulation strips cannot make direct contact with sunlight, and aging of sealing strips due to the fact that the heat insulation strips are exposed to the sunlight for a long time is avoided.
